So my new bunny peanut is very,very shy. I tried the same things that I did with my first bun. And so far they haven't really worked. I tried just sitting and ignoring him. But he does NOT get curious about me at all. So I decided to try something different. I got him out of his cage and sat with him on the couch. I put him on my chest nuzzled against my neck. He was pretty scared, he was shaking. But then he would calm down and at one point looked like he was falling asleep. I spoke to him calmly a petted him. We sat like that for an hour! Then he started to get restless and I put him back. Today I did the same thing and at first he was scared, but he calmed much quicker. He even got a little more curious and started looking around. At one point my dog walked by and spooked him. He ran straight up to my neck and nuzzled me. Then he started to kind of play around. Digging on my jacket and zipper. Whenever he is spooked he runs up to my neck again. He sits with me for about an hour before he gets restless. What do you think? It seems like it's working. Do you think that 1 hour is too long for him to sit with me?

I think what you did with your boy is good. Every bunny has his/her own personality. Some easily get along well with others of humans, some take more time to get used to be around people or be surrounded by other creatures. :) We'd worked hard on bonding with our girl and believe me, our girl took quite some time to get used to us as well. Be patient and trust your baby boy. Let him getting to know you and get used to your environment and one day, I'm sure, he will be a loving bunny boy. With my experience, bonding time should be in a quiet place, no other distraction, just you and him. It will help your bun being more calm.
